Talla Todi
Talla Todi is a village located in Paraswada tehsil of Balaghat district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 42km away from sub-district headquarter Paraswada (tehsildar office) and 26km away from district headquarter Balaghat. As per 2009 stats, Dadkasa is the gram panchayat of Talla Todi village.

About Talla Todi
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Talla Todi is 498466. The village spans a total geographical area of 63 hectares. Balaghat is nearest town to Talla Todi village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 26km away.
When it comes to local governance, Talla Todi village is administered by a Sarpanch, the elected head of the village, in accordance with the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. The village falls under the Baihar Vidhan Sabha constituency for state-level representation and the Balaghat Lok Sabha constituency for national parliamentary elections. Population of Talla Todi
Below is a concise population overview of Talla Todi as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 89 | 40 | 49 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 14 | 3 | 11 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 2 | 1 | 1 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 87 | 39 | 48 |
Literate Population | 28 | 15 | 13 |
Illiterate Population | 61 | 25 | 36 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Talla Todi village:
- The total population of Talla Todi village is around 89, including approximately 40 males and 49 females, with a sex ratio of 1225 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 14 children aged 0–6 years in Talla Todi village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Talla Todi village has 2 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 87 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
- The literacy rate of Talla Todi village is about 31.46%, with male literacy at 37.50% and female literacy at 26.53%.
- There are around 17 households in Talla Todi village.
Connectivity of Talla Todi
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Talla Todi. As per the 2011 stats, Talla Todi had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
